Output a521387e6dc605f39f659c4be56f6ac455420c52ea58fd24f11e26112898d590:0

value
31412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80d51a4ea453cc89e60cf46dc8457fee0897aea OP_EQUAL
address
3MPPqPoz9oKTogpkMp6YAoWA6pHpyBiM7o
transaction
a521387e6dc605f39f659c4be56f6ac455420c52ea58fd24f11e26112898d590
spent
true